In a world where dating can often feel like a game of chance, Gracie, a female dating coach, is offering a fresh perspective that’s resonating with many. Her recent video, which has garnered over 201,000 views in just six days, suggests that the key to confidence in dating isn’t the outcome, but the willingness to embrace the process, regardless of the result .


Gracie’s viral advice is straightforward yet profound: “Don’t focus on the outcome.” She argues that men who are willing to face rejection and failure are the ones who show more initiative and ultimately thrive in their romantic endeavors. This mindset shift, according to Gracie, is the secret that all confident men understand .

In her video, Gracie, who goes by @datingwithgracie on TikTok, shares her insights as a coach who assists men in breaking free from the barriers that hold them back in their dating lives. She emphasizes the importance of action over fear, stating, “Confident guys are much more afraid of what will happen if they don’t [approach women]. So, they go for it anyway.”

While Gracie’s message has struck a chord with many, it has also sparked a debate among viewers. Some men have expressed that stepping back from dating and focusing on self-esteem and personal happiness has been more beneficial for their confidence. Others agree with the essence of Gracie’s message but don’t see it as particularly groundbreaking, echoing sentiments like, “You miss 100 percent of the shots you don’t take.”

Despite the mixed reactions, Gracie stands firm in her belief that taking action is crucial in the pursuit of love. She encourages men to actively seek what they desire, with the conviction that finding their dream partner is only a matter of time .
